Job description
The Role

Based in Ottawa, the Traffic Coordinator, reports directly to the COO and is an integral part of the day-to-day operation of the channel, contributing to CPAC’s regulatory compliance and working on strategic programming files. The ideal candidate is detail-oriented and confident making decisions in a dynamic environment.

Primary Responsibilities
  • Prepare and maintain daily broadcast logs, ensuring programming and promos meet contractual and regulatory requirements.
  • Assign program elements (titles, categories, languages, formats, metadata) into scheduling software and maintain accurate program records.
  • Oversee the workflows for simultaneous interpretation and closed captioning and work with external vendors to ensure regulatory compliance.
  • Schedule and reconcile logs daily, resolving playback or scheduling issues as they arise.
  • Coordinate with Programming, Promotions, and Master Control to ensure accurate placement and delivery of content.
  • Monitor and report on compliance requirements (CRTC categories, Canadian content, closed captioning, interpretation, original hours).
  • Communicate program schedules and changes. Highlight internally and to third-party listings services (IPG/EPG/TV guides).
  • Track and report on broadcast statistics, including weekly Numeris data and internal compliance metrics.
  • Troubleshoot technical or scheduling issues affecting on-air playback.
  • Support other operational and programming needs as required.
Skills & Qualifications
  • Diploma/degree in broadcasting, television/radio production, or equivalent experience.
  • Minimum 3+ years’ experience in traffic, programming, or broadcast operations.
  • Strong knowledge of CRTC logging and broadcast compliance standards.
  • Proficiency with traffic/scheduling software and media asset management tools (e.g., BroadView, Dalet).
  • Working knowledge of the MS Office Suite, including Outlook, SharePoint and Teams.
  • Adept with Excel including basic VBA macros, advanced formulas, conditional formatting
  • Exceptional attention to detail, organization, and problem-solving skills.
  • Demonstrates sound judgment in complex, ambiguous environments.
  • Ability to manage multiple priorities and meet strict deadlines in a dynamic environment.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ills in order to work effectively with internal teams and external partners.
  • Bilingualism (English/French) considered a strong asset

This is a full time, regular position with competitive benefits. The successful candidate will be required to work primarily in the Ottawa office.
